Understanding Leg Swelling: More Than Just a Puffy Ankle

Leg swelling, or peripheral edema, occurs when tiny blood vessels (capillaries) leak fluid. This fluid builds up in the surrounding tissues, leading to noticeable puffiness, often in the ankles, feet, and lower legs. Gravity plays a significant role, which is why swelling is frequently more prominent in the lower extremities.

It’s important to remember that edema itself is a symptom, not a disease. It can stem from a wide array of conditions, ranging from simple lifestyle factors to complex underlying medical issues. Pinpointing the exact cause is key to effective management and treatment.

Common Causes of Leg Swelling Beyond the Heart

Before we dive deep into the heart connection, it’s helpful to be aware of other frequent culprits behind leg swelling. Many of these are less serious but still warrant attention if persistent. For example, prolonged standing or sitting, especially during long flights or car rides, can cause temporary fluid buildup.

Hot weather can also lead to mild swelling as blood vessels expand, making it harder for fluid to return to the heart. Minor injuries, such as a sprain or strain, can cause localized swelling. Pregnancy is another common cause, as the growing uterus puts pressure on blood vessels in the pelvis, impeding blood flow from the legs.

Other medical conditions can also contribute. Kidney disease can impair the body’s ability to excrete sodium and water, leading to generalized edema. Liver disease, particularly cirrhosis, can reduce the production of proteins that help keep fluid in the bloodstream, resulting in fluid leakage into tissues. Venous insufficiency, a condition where leg veins struggle to return blood to the heart, is also a very common cause of chronic leg swelling.

The Critical Link: Leg Swelling and Heart Failure

Now, let’s address the central concern: the relationship between leg swelling and heart failure. When your heart, the body’s primary pump, isn’t working as efficiently as it should, it can struggle to circulate blood effectively. This reduced pumping action is the hallmark of heart failure, and it has profound effects throughout the body.

One of the most noticeable consequences is the backup of blood in the veins, leading to increased pressure. This elevated pressure forces fluid out of the capillaries and into the surrounding tissues, especially in the lower extremities due to gravity. This is why puffy ankles and legs are a classic symptom of heart failure, particularly right-sided heart failure.

How Heart Failure Causes Swelling: A Closer Look

The mechanism by which heart failure leads to edema is quite intricate. In essence, when the heart’s pumping capacity is compromised, blood doesn’t flow forward as it should. This causes a ‘traffic jam’ in the venous system.

If the right side of the heart is weakened, it struggles to pump blood into the lungs. This causes blood to back up in the veins that carry blood from the body back to the heart, leading to increased pressure in the systemic circulation. This increased pressure, combined with gravity, pushes fluid out of the blood vessels and into the tissues of the legs, ankles, and sometimes even the abdomen.

Even left-sided heart failure, which primarily affects blood flow to the body from the lungs, can eventually lead to systemic edema. When the left side fails, blood backs up in the lungs, causing pulmonary edema (fluid in the lungs) and shortness of breath. Over time, the strain on the right side of the heart increases, potentially leading to its failure as well, thus causing fluid retention in the legs. Furthermore, the body’s kidneys, sensing reduced blood flow from the failing heart, may try to compensate by retaining more sodium and water, further exacerbating the fluid overload.

Recognizing Warning Signs: When to Seek Medical Attention

While some forms of leg swelling are harmless, it’s vital to know when to be concerned. Any new, unexplained, or worsening leg swelling should always prompt a visit to your doctor. Pay particular attention if the swelling is sudden in onset, or if it affects only one leg, as this could indicate a deep vein thrombosis (DVT), a serious blood clot.

If your leg swelling is accompanied by other symptoms, it’s even more critical to seek prompt medical evaluation. These red flags include shortness of breath, especially when lying flat or during exertion, chest pain or discomfort, unusual fatigue, dizziness, or a rapid or irregular heartbeat. These could all be indicators pointing towards a cardiovascular issue requiring urgent attention.

Diagnostic Steps for Leg Swelling

When you consult a doctor for leg swelling, they will typically start with a thorough medical history and physical examination. They will ask about the onset, duration, and characteristics of the swelling, as well as any other symptoms you might be experiencing. The physical exam will assess the extent and type of edema, check for skin changes, and evaluate your heart and lung sounds.

Further diagnostic tests may include blood tests to check kidney function, liver function, thyroid hormone levels, and a B-type natriuretic peptide (BNP) level, which can indicate heart strain. An electrocardiogram (ECG) and an echocardiogram (a heart ultrasound) are often performed to assess heart structure and function directly. These tests help your doctor accurately diagnose the underlying cause and guide appropriate treatment.

Managing Leg Swelling and Heart Failure

Managing leg swelling effectively depends entirely on addressing its root cause. For non-cardiac causes like prolonged standing, simple measures like elevating your legs, regular movement, and wearing compression stockings can be very effective. However, when swelling in legs is linked to heart failure, the treatment strategy becomes more comprehensive, focusing on optimizing heart function and managing fluid retention.

Doctors will often prescribe diuretics, commonly known as water pills, to help your kidneys remove excess sodium and water from your body, thereby reducing fluid buildup. Other medications, such as ACE inhibitors, beta-blockers, and mineralocorticoid receptor antagonists, are crucial for improving heart function and preventing the progression of heart failure. Lifestyle adjustments are equally vital, including strict sodium restriction in your diet and careful monitoring of fluid intake. Regular, gentle exercise, as advised by your doctor, can also improve circulation and reduce swelling.

Characteristic Heart-Related Leg Swelling Other Common Causes of Leg Swelling
Affected Area Typically affects both legs (bilateral), starting in ankles/feet, potentially moving up. Can be unilateral (e.g., DVT, injury, local infection) or bilateral (e.g., venous insufficiency, kidney/liver disease, medications).
Pitting Edema Often ‘pitting,’ meaning an indentation remains after pressing on the swollen area. Can also be pitting (e.g., venous insufficiency, kidney disease) or non-pitting (e.g., lymphedema, thyroid issues).
Associated Symptoms Often accompanied by shortness of breath, fatigue, chest pain, weight gain, cough, dizziness. Depends on cause: pain/redness (injury/infection), skin changes (venous insufficiency), jaundice (liver disease), reduced urine (kidney disease).
Timing/Progression Worsens throughout the day, often more pronounced in the evenings; gradual onset. Can vary: sudden (DVT, injury), constant (lymphedema), or worse after prolonged standing (venous insufficiency).
Skin Changes Skin may appear stretched, shiny, or discolored (bluish/purplish) over time. Redness/warmth (infection), brown discoloration/ulcers (venous insufficiency), thickened/hardened skin (lymphedema).
Response to Elevation May temporarily improve with elevation, but often returns quickly. Generally improves with elevation, especially for benign causes or venous insufficiency.

Q2: What specific characteristics of leg swelling should make me suspect a heart issue versus something else?

When considering if leg swelling points to a heart issue, look for several key characteristics. Heart-related swelling, often due to heart failure, typically affects both legs (bilateral) and often presents as ‘pitting edema,’ meaning that if you press firmly on the swollen area with your finger for a few seconds, an indentation remains. This swelling tends to be worse at the end of the day, after gravity has pulled fluid downwards, and may improve overnight or with elevation. Crucially, it’s often accompanied by other heart failure symptoms like shortness of breath (especially when lying flat or during exertion), unusual fatigue, a persistent cough, or unexplained weight gain from fluid retention. In contrast, swelling from venous insufficiency might also be bilateral and pitting but is usually not associated with significant shortness of breath. Swelling from a blood clot (DVT) or infection is typically unilateral (one leg) and might involve pain, redness, and warmth. Kidney disease can cause more generalized swelling, including around the eyes, while liver disease might involve abdominal swelling (ascites) and jaundice. Observing these distinctions helps guide your suspicion towards a cardiac cause.

Q3: Besides medication, what lifestyle changes can help manage leg swelling related to heart conditions?

Beyond prescribed medications, several lifestyle changes are vital for managing leg swelling associated with heart conditions. First and foremost is strict dietary sodium restriction. Sodium causes the body to retain water, so limiting processed foods, salty snacks, and adding less salt to meals can significantly reduce fluid buildup. Aim for less than 2,000 mg of sodium per day, or as advised by your doctor. Secondly, careful fluid intake management, though often less restrictive than sodium, may be recommended in advanced heart failure to prevent fluid overload. Regular, gentle physical activity, such as walking, helps improve circulation and reduces fluid pooling in the legs. Always consult your doctor before starting any new exercise regimen. Elevating your legs above heart level for 15-30 minutes several times a day can help drain fluid back towards the torso. Wearing compression stockings, as recommended by your doctor, can also provide external support to veins, helping to prevent fluid accumulation and improve blood flow. Lastly, maintaining a healthy weight reduces the overall burden on your heart and circulatory system.

Q4: Is it possible for leg swelling to be the only symptom of heart failure, or are there usually other signs?

While leg swelling can sometimes be the most prominent or even the initial noticeable symptom of heart failure, it’s quite rare for it to be the *only* symptom, especially as the condition progresses. Heart failure is a complex syndrome, and it typically manifests with a constellation of symptoms. However, in the very early stages, or in specific types of heart failure, swelling might be subtle and easily dismissed, while other symptoms like mild fatigue or slightly reduced exercise tolerance might be less obvious to the individual. As heart failure advances, other hallmark signs usually emerge, such as increasing shortness of breath (dyspnea), particularly with exertion or when lying down (orthopnea), persistent coughing or wheezing, significant fatigue, unexplained weight gain due to fluid retention, and difficulty sleeping. Therefore, while swelling can be a critical clue, doctors will always look for a broader pattern of symptoms and conduct comprehensive tests to confirm a diagnosis of heart failure, emphasizing that a thorough medical assessment is always necessary.

Q5: How do doctors differentiate leg swelling caused by heart failure from swelling caused by kidney or liver disease?

Differentiating the cause of leg swelling among heart, kidney, and liver disease involves a combination of medical history, physical examination, and specific diagnostic tests. For heart failure, doctors look for associated symptoms like shortness of breath, fatigue, and a history of heart disease, along with signs like elevated jugular venous pressure on exam. Blood tests will often show elevated BNP levels, and an echocardiogram will directly assess heart function and structure. In kidney disease, swelling can be more generalized, affecting the face and hands in addition to legs, and is often accompanied by reduced urine output. Blood tests will reveal elevated creatinine and urea levels, indicating impaired kidney function, and urinalysis might show protein in the urine. For liver disease, swelling often comes with other symptoms like jaundice (yellow skin/eyes), easy bruising, and abdominal swelling (ascites). Blood tests will show abnormal liver enzymes and low albumin levels, which is a protein produced by the liver that helps keep fluid in blood vessels. The combination of these clinical clues and specific lab and imaging results allows doctors to pinpoint the underlying cause of the edema and initiate appropriate, targeted treatment.
